Bulawayo, Rhodesia: Books of Rhodesia Publishing Co.. Very Good in Very Good dust jacket; Edges rubbed, store sticker inside . front cover, light foxing of fore-edge. Jacket lightly toned and rubbed.. 1975. Reprint; Second Printing. Hardcover. Red cloth. 9 page publisher introduction, xxii, 457pp. Tipped-in black and white frontispiece illustration, black and white photos and illustrations, index, appendices. Rhodesiana Reprint Library Volume 12 is a facsimile reproduction of the 1899 edition, with additions, which spoke of pioneer life, race relations, and social and cultural conditions in this part of Africa. ; 8vo 8" - 9" tall .
